Applications
Isophthalic acid is used as an intermediate for high performance unsaturated polyesters, resins for coatings, high solids paints, gel coats and modifier of polyethylene terephthalate for bottles. It acts as precursors for the fire-resistant material nomex as well as used in the preparation of high-performance polymer polybenzimidazole. It is also employed as an input for the production of insulation materials.

Solubility
Insoluble in water.

Notes
Incompatible with strong oxidizing agents and strong bases.
